Перейти к публикации
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...

Иероглифы в админка/дополнения


neomax
 Поделиться

Рекомендованные сообщения

Подскажите - После установки модификатора - на сайте и в админке все работает нормально кроме одного момента.

А именно на всех страницах админки все в порядке, но на вкладке менеджер дополнений 33.thumb.jpg.cab49915410f7fa8f864ae1df269decb.jpg -       происходит следующая картина - 55.thumb.jpg.4879d7719756f584e5ad63037bb3adc8.jpg.

После удаления модификатора и очистки кэша проблема отображения (Кодировки) Менеджера дополнений в Админ-панели остается. То есть ошибка была до этого и обновление модификаторов лишь отобразило ее. Обратно в нормальный вид привести не могу.

Почитал в просторах интернета - кто то пишет что проблема может быть в том, что у какого то файла кодировка не такая как должна быть (UTF-8 без BOM).

Gzip сжатие - отключено (0). Модуль поиска файлов с кодировкой без BOM - тоже ничего не выявил - чистый лист.

Версия ocStore 2.1.0.2.1, Шаблон Unishop Template.

 

Прошу помощи или рекомендаций что и где исправить?

 

Ссылка на комментарий
Поделиться на других сайтах


5 минут назад, anboza сказал:

проверьте, чтобы в настройках сайта на хостинге, было: UTF-8

 

Помогло убрать иероглифы, Спасибо.

Но теперь раздел менеджер дополнений долго прогружается и внизу появилась вот такая строка

Fatal error: Allowed memory size of 67108864 bytes exhausted (tried to allocate 13843998 bytes) in /home/СЕРВЕР/САЙТ.ru/docs/vqmod/vqcache/vq2-system_storage_modification_system_engine_loader.php on line 82

 

Ссылка на комментарий
Поделиться на других сайтах


Вопрос закрыт, За помощь спасибо.

Там же в настройках PHP модуля на хостинге поставил 

Максимальный объём памяти для работы скрипта 256 м, стояло значение  64 м и скрипту не хватало памяти.
Ссылка на комментарий
Поделиться на других сайтах


Один из модификаторов может быть "битым". При любой подобной проблеме, начинать нужно с полного отключения всех модификаторов и очистки кеша модификаторов.

После этого по одному включаем каждый модификатор и обновляем кеш (тех же модификаторов, не браузера).

Проблемный после включения сам себя выдаст.

1 час назад, neomax сказал:

САЙТ.ru/docs/vqmod/vqcache/vq2-system_storage_modification_system_engine_loader.php on line 82

Наличие Vqmod в опенкарт версии 2 и выше , грубейшая ошибка.

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

12 минут назад, Tom сказал:

Один из модификаторов может быть "битым". При любой подобной проблеме, начинать нужно с полного отключения всех модификаторов и очистки кеша модификаторов.

После этого по одному включаем каждый модификатор и обновляем кеш (тех же модификаторов, не браузера).

Проблемный после включения сам себя выдаст.

Наличие Vqmod в опенкарт версии 2 и выше , грубейшая ошибка.

Про Vqmod в опенкарт версии 2 и выше , грубейшая ошибка - поясните почему?

Ссылка на комментарий
Поделиться на других сайтах


Потому что в опенкарт этой версии используется аналогичный встроенный инструмент Ocmod. Два вместе, это как два седла на одной лошади.

  • +1 2
Ссылка на комментарий
Поделиться на других сайтах

10 минут назад, Tom сказал:

Потому что в опенкарт этой версии используется аналогичный встроенный инструмент Ocmod. Два вместе, это как два седла на одной лошади.

Ну наверное на тот момент когда это делалось - необходимые дополнения были только на Vqmod - поэтому он и есть.

Как переделать все это - это наверно слишком сложно для меня.

Вопрос: - Жить с этим можно? Сайту вреда не будет?

 

P/S/ Отключение всех модификаторов и чистка кеша - строчку не убирает. Дело не в модификаторах а в чем то другом.

Пока могу решить проблему только увеличением объема памяти на выполняемый скрипт.

Если есть мысли -  готов выслушать, но прошу отнестись со снисхождением - я неопытный юзер. Что то схватываю - что -то могу сразу не понять.

Ссылка на комментарий
Поделиться на других сайтах


Память не при чём. Суть этих файлов , что Ocmod , что VQmod, не меняя файлы, вносить в них необходимые для определённой задачи изменения. И обе эти системы хранят, те самые изменённые ими файлы в кеше, именно поэтому его постоянно чистят, что бы при обновлении появились уже нужные правки.

А имея два таких инструмента, с двумя папками кеша, нужно в два раза больше телодвижений и для пользователя и для магазина.

Ну и в вашем случае, искать проблему нужно ещё и в Vqmod файлах. А причина, банально может быть в том, что какой то файл был например открыт и правился в обычном блокноте. Или при загрузке был загружен не полностью. Ну и если честно ещё 100500 причин. Большая часть которых это именно наличие ещё и Vqmod.

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

10 минут назад, Tom сказал:

Память не при чём. Суть этих файлов , что Ocmod , что VQmod, не меняя файлы, вносить в них необходимые для определённой задачи изменения. И обе эти системы хранят, те самые изменённые ими файлы в кеше, именно поэтому его постоянно чистят, что бы при обновлении появились уже нужные правки.

А имея два таких инструмента, с двумя папками кеша, нужно в два раза больше телодвижений и для пользователя и для магазина.

Ну и в вашем случае, искать проблему нужно ещё и в Vqmod файлах. А причина, банально может быть в том, что какой то файл был например открыт и правился в обычном блокноте. Или при загрузке был загружен не полностью. Ну и если честно ещё 100500 причин. Большая часть которых это именно наличие ещё и Vqmod.

 

ТОгда еще вопрос если можно, точнее  2:

У меня в папке Vqmod/xml - вот такой список дополнений:

autocalc_price_option_OC2_v3.0.4.ocmod.xml

extra_product_tab_admin.xml

extra_product_tab_catalog.xml

image_mods.ocmod.xml

install.xml

multi_image_upload_free.ocmod.xml

products_mods.ocmod.xml

quick_edit.ocmod.xml

vqmod_opencart.xml

 

Есть ли смысл казнить весь VQmod?

Можно ли файлы с окончанием *ocmod.xml из этого списка залить через добавление дополнений в Админке(будут ли они работать?)?

 

 

Ссылка на комментарий
Поделиться на других сайтах


У вас там в куче и мухи и котлеты.

название_файла.ocmod.xml  - это так называемые Модификаторы ( Ocmod ), устанавливаются через админку  (второй способ в папку систем, но пока не вникать).

название_файла.xml  - это файлы vqmod.

install.xml - так же файл Ocmod, но он идёт в архиве и ставить его как то иначе, не нужно. Только целиком архивом и только из админки.

Отсюда и все беды, потому что в магазине бардак.

Изменено пользователем Tom
  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

Журнал ocmod удалите, похоже это он память переполняет.

  • +1 1
Ссылка на комментарий
Поделиться на других сайтах

9 часов назад, Tom сказал:

У вас там в куче и мухи и котлеты.

название_файла.ocmod.xml  - это так называемые Модификаторы ( Ocmod ), устанавливаются через админку  (второй способ в папку систем, но пока не вникать).

название_файла.xml  - это файлы vqmod.

install.xml - так же файл Ocmod, но он идёт в архиве и ставить его как то иначе, не нужно. Только целиком архивом и только из админки.

Отсюда и все беды, потому что в магазине бардак.

 

Понял, буду что думать. спасибо за науку.

Ссылка на комментарий
Поделиться на других сайтах


7 часов назад, shoputils сказал:

Журнал ocmod удалите, похоже это он память переполняет.

 

Бинго!!!  Вернул размер памяти для скрипта обратно до 64 м. 

Почистил из админки лог дополнений.

Все летает.

Благодарю за наводку.

Ссылка на комментарий
Поделиться на других сайтах


  • 1 год спустя...
7 минут назад, kartrige сказал:

Добрый  день !  ПОдскажите , вся  админка  и  сам  сайт соответственно в иероглифах , как  это поправить

место на хостинге закончилось

удалять от мусора или увеличивать

Ссылка на комментарий
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
 Подел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обработка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фиденциальности.